How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Penn Hills?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Penn Hills Studio Apartments | $1,018 | $575 | $1,637 |
Penn Hills 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,254 | $595 | $3,100 |
Penn Hills 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,613 | $795 | $3,279 |
Penn Hills 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,907 | $845 | $3,065 |
Penn Hills 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,000 | $2,000 | $2,000 |

Largest Available Penn Hills and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Penn Hills, PA is found at Highland House Tower by Albion in the Homewood North neighborhood and is 1,602 square feet priced from $2,655. Kelly Hamilton Homes in the East Hills neighborhood has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,507 square feet and currently listed start at $1,550.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Penn Hills: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Highland House Tower by Albion | D1p | 1,602 Sq Ft | $2,655 |
Kelly Hamilton Homes | 3 Bedroom Townhouse | 1,507 Sq Ft | $1,550 |
Cornerstone Village Apartments | 3 Bedroom Townhouse Tax Credit*** | 1,338 Sq Ft | $1,531 |
River Oaks Townhomes at Fox Chapel | 3X1.5 - C1 | 1,230 Sq Ft | $2,200 |
Brinton Manor | 3 Bedroom Market | 1,000 Sq Ft | $1,350 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
